Lummus Novolen Technology GmbH (Novolen) has been a licensor in the field of polypropylene for over 50 years. Our Novolen® technology is one of the world's leading polypropylene technologies, with 22 million tons of annual production licensed capacity. Novolen® technology also includes NHP® catalysts for the production of the high-performance polypropylene products PPure™, Novolen Enhance™ and Novolen CirPPlus™, which find their application in a variety of consumer products.

Novolen is part of the globally active Lummus Technology group.

In addition to developing, elaborating and offering process and plant concepts for the production of polypropylene, our range of activities also includes the development and optimization of polypropylene catalysts and propylene polymers, their testing and evaluation, as well as technical consulting and support for licensees.
